My dog's breathing changed after spay and weight gain. What to do?

Hello, not a question about my dog, but about my grandmas dog: she’s 6 years old and was neutered about a year ago. Ever since then she has gain a few pounds but I’ve heard that’s common. What I find weird is that she started to breath really weirdly. I cant really explain how it sounds, but it’s definitely not how she breathed before.

Thank you for submitting your question regarding your grandmother's dog. I recommend that she sees a veterinarian if her breathing has changed. It may simply be a result of her weight gain. However, she could have a respiratory infection or even a heart problem. For this reason, it is best to have her seen and to work on weight loss with her. I hope this information helps!
